Five Nights at Freddy’s 2 earns $63 million in North America, topping the box office despite poor reviews, while Zootopia 2 takes second place

LOS ANGELES: Horror video-game sequel “Five Nights at Freddy’s 2” debuted at the top of the North American box office.

The Universal film earned an estimated $63 million from Friday to Sunday, according to Exhibitor Relations.

It added another $46 million from international markets.

“The audience score is more important, and it’s very good for a horror picture, although not as good as the first pic,” said David A. Gross of Franchise Entertainment Research.

Disney’s animated sequel “Zootopia 2” slid to second place with $43 million in its second weekend.

The film has now earned a domestic total of $220 million and is nearing $1 billion worldwide.

Universal’s “Wicked: For Good” dropped one spot to third, earning $16.8 million in its third weekend.

The musical is the second chapter retelling the story of Oz’s witches Elphaba and Glinda.

Anime film “JUJUTSU KAISEN: Execution” landed in fourth place with a $10.2 million debut.

Lionsgate’s heist film “Now You See Me: Now You Don’t” rounded out the top five with $3.5 million. – AFP
